Histoire
Pie in the Sky follows the obsessive pursuit of a young man driven by his two consuming passions: unraveling traffic gridlock and reuniting with his first love. The narrative revolves around his quest to decode traffic patterns and find his way back to the avant-garde dancer who once stole his heart.
Résumé
Pie in the Sky is a romantic comedy directed by Bryan Gordon, released in 1996. Set in Los Angeles, California, the film centers around a young man's career obsession with unraveling traffic patterns and his enduring love for an avant-garde dancer. The movie is notable for its unique blend of humor and romance, woven together through the protagonist's quest to decipher the city's gridlock and rekindle his past love.
